7 SECTION 2. Article 5.05, Code of Criminal Procedure, is
8 amended by amending Subsection (a) and adding Subsection (a-2) to
9 read as follows:
10 (a) A peace officer who investigates a family violence
11 incident or who responds to a disturbance call that may involve
12 family violence shall make a written report, including but not
13 limited to:
14 (1) the names of the suspect and complainant;
15 (2) the date, time, and location of the incident;
16 . (3) any visible or reported injuries; [a4]
17 (4) a description of the incident and a statement of
18 its disposition; and
19 (5) whether the suspect is a member of the state
20 military forces or is serving in the armed forces of the United
21 States in an active-duty status.
